Vuosien päässä on paikka
It Takes Years to Reach UsDirector: Mikael Rutkiewicz,Country: FinnishYear: 2024Genre: DocumentaryDuration: 20 minA shared moment by a fire in the remains of an Eastern Finnish rural community. The lines between light and dark, past and present start to waver. It Takes Years to Reach Us is a meditation on remembering while we drift on.

Peijaiset
Bear with MeDirector: Jasmin GummerusCountry: FinnishYear: 2024Genre: FictionDuration: 18 minIt was supposed to be the perfect day for the 25-year-old birthday girl Donna, but everything is about to be ruined because her friends don’t follow her plans. The carefully organized activities turn into a game of “who is who’s favorite.” When even her best friend betrays her, the beast inside Donna awakens.

Pieniä ajatuksia naapuruudesta
Small Notes About My NeighboursDirector: Anna TörrönenCountry: FinnishYear: 2024Genre: DocumentaryDuration: 19 minSmall Notes About My Neighbours is a multi-vocal essay film about a yellow house, its neighbours, its surroundings, and growing up. Combining fragmented footage from one location, it approaches a shared place from unexpected points of view with the curiosity of a child. Worms, snails, rats and birds all go about their cycles just like spring, summer, fall and winter do.

Illan vika
MeanwhileDirector: Ysmin NajjarCountry: FinnishYear: 2024Genre: FictionDuration: 18 min27-year-old Mona works alone at a remote grill, is once again studying for her upcoming entrance exams, and endlessly misses her spouse Helga, who is away on a business trip. A new employee starts at the grill: 19-year-old lively and unbalanced Leo, who in all his likability makes Mona miss her past.

Mereneläviä
Fish River AnthologyDirector: Veera LamminpääCountry: FinnishYear: 2024Genre: AnimationDuration: 10 minThe supermarket is nearing its closing time, and the last customers are queuing for their turn at the fish counter. The agonizing wait offers a chance for existential reflection and a little song.
